Output 682622f508e10814744118aed4f8697b992701450ed11ab90f30bd5d86b596f3:0

value
153868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7fb54545efe546e51854e7b7ab837c742e30503 OP_EQUAL
address
3H1DrFdr1L4YvaVo9cdLpXMzYxR6nXHGg1
transaction
682622f508e10814744118aed4f8697b992701450ed11ab90f30bd5d86b596f3
confirmations
166870
spent
true